#660054 - Pompadour Hex Color Code

#660054 (Pompadour) - RGB 102, 0, 84 Color Information

#660054 Conversion Table

HEX Triplet 66, 00, 54
RGB Decimal 102, 0, 84
RGB Octal 146, 0, 124
RGB Percent 40%, 0%, 32.9%
RGB Binary 1100110, 0, 1010100
CMY 0.600, 1.000, 0.671
CMYK 0, 100, 18, 60

Color spaces of #660054 Pompadour - RGB(102, 0, 84)

HSV (or HSB) 311°, 100°, 40°
HSL 311°, 100°, 20°
Web Safe #660066
XYZ 7.080, 3.465, 8.683
CIE-Lab 21.817, 47.372, -20.885
xyY 0.368, 0.180, 3.465
Decimal 6684756

What is the C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) color model of #660054?

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#660054 is composed of 0% Cyan, 100% Magenta, 18% Yellow, and 60%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 0%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 100%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 18%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 60%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.
